Health of the Indigenous Peoples Initiative
|
Purpose: In collaboration with the indigenous peoples themselves, to find realistic and sustainable solutions to the serious problems of poor health and substandard living conditions that are the reality of many of the indigenous peoples throughout the Region. Lines of work: National policies and international agreements, networks of interinstitutional and intersectoral collaboration; primary health care and intercultural approach to health; and information analysis, monitoring, and management. |

Social Determinants of Health
|
|
The social, political and economical conditions have a strong influence on health; these are the called social determinants of health. The context in which the different population groups evolve should be understood, as well, their culture and knowledge should be valued for the application of policies pursuing the decrement of inequities. |
